Abstract
A power supply includes a DC-DC converter, a boost converter, an energy storage element; and a voltage clamping circuit. The DC-DC converter is connected to a power source with an output voltage in a first voltage range. The voltage clamper circuit is configured to discharge at least a portion of energy of the energy storage element and to produce current at a clamped output voltage range that is substantially equal to the first voltage range. The discharged energy provides hold-up time for the power supply.
